Compare water energy with fossil fuels in terms of pollution and usage.

Water Energy:
-Not much pollution
-Different ways to get energy (From falling water, from hot steam, etc)

Fossil Fuels:
-Very polluting
-The main way of obtaining energy is to burn the fuel(Such as coal)
